代码拉取完成,页面将自动刷新
或许是极人性化的一个文档管理框架,最适合部署在内网作为内网文档管理,url即目录层级。markdown+git+web搭配,让你一下子就喜欢上写文档分享。一分钟上手,有兴趣可挖掘隐藏技巧。
零安装、零配置,无数据库,不需要composer,开箱即用。只需要你有一台安装了git命令行,php5.3,nginx环境的linux机器。
vi Config.php
return [
// 项目留空保存文档和附件的git地址,可以是在github,好吧,不想公开,可以bitbucket。
// 1.php进程的用户的id_rsa.pub已添加到git的ssh-key。这样才可以推送markdown下的文件。
'git' => 'git@github.com:meolu/Walden-markdown-demo.git',
// 2.好吧,如果实在不想加key,可以直接明文用户名密码认证的http(s)地址也可以。
// 'git' => 'https://username:password@github.com/meolu/Walden-markdown-demo.git',
];
server {
listen 80;
server_name Walden.dev;
root /the/dir/of/Walden;
index index.php;
# 建议放内网做文档服务
#allow 192.168.0.0/24;
#deny all;
location / {
try_files $uri $uri/ /index.php$is_args$args;
}
location ~ \.php$ {
try_files $uri =404;
fastcgi_pass 127.0.0.1:9000;
fastcgi_param SCRIPT_FILENAME $document_root$fastcgi_script_name;
include fastcgi_params;
}
}
前端同学可以自己定义模板,在templates下新建一个模板目录,包含预览模板:markdown-detail-view.php
,编辑模板:markdown-editor-view.php
,然后修改Config.php
的template
为你的模板项目。
最后,当然希望你可以给此项目提个pull request,目前只有一个bootstrap的默认模板:(
瓦尔登的版本记录:CHANGELOG
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。
1. 开源生态
2. 协作、人、软件
3. 评估模型